Princeton's WordNet
vice president, V.P.noun
an executive officer ranking immediately below a president; may serve in the president's place under certain circumstances
Wiktionary
vice presidentnoun
A deputy to a president, often empowered to assume the position of president on his death or absence
vice presidentnoun
An executive in a business in charge of a department or branch
Vice Presidentnoun
The secondary office to the President of the United States, being the first in line of succession to the President, and also acting as presiding officer of the U.S. Senate.
Etymology: From vice and president
ChatGPT
vice president
A vice president is a high-ranking official who is below the president in an organization's hierarchy, serving as a second-in-command. The vice president's duties vary depending on the organization but often include taking over the president's responsibilities in the event they are absent or incapable. This position exists in various entities such as government, corporations, non-profit organizations, and more.
Wikidata
Vice President
A vice president is an officer in government or business who is below a president in rank. The name comes from the Latin vice meaning 'in place of'. In some countries, the vice president is called the deputy president. A common colloquial term for the office is vee-pee, deriving from a phonetic interpretation of the abbreviation VP.
